Handling Precautions
Although ESD protection circuitry has been designed into the VS-500 proper precautions should be taken when
handling and mounting. VI employs a human body model and a charged-device model (CDM) for ESD
susceptibility testing and design protection evaluation.

The device has been qualified to meet the JEDEC
standard for Pb-Free assembly. The temperatures
and time intervals listed are based on the Pb-Free
small body requirements. The temperatures refer to
the topside of the package, measured on the
package body surface. The VS-500 device is
hermetically sealed so an aqueous wash is not an
issue.
